Chinese e-commerce giant Alibaba to invest $2B in Türkiye – Daily Sabah

… Business · Automotive · Economy · Energy · Finance · Tourism · Tech · Defense · Transportation · News Analysis. Chinese ecommerce giant Alibaba to …

Read the full article